  • John Gyse, Esq. was born circa 1485 at of Elmore, Gloucestershire, England; Age 16 in 1501.1,2,4 He married Tacy Grey, daughter of Sir John Grey, 8th Lord Grey of Wilton and Anne Grey, circa 1510; They had 3 sons (Anselm; William, Esq; & John) and 4 daughters (Silvester, wife of Sir John Butler; Margaret, wife of Anthony Bellett; Sibyl; & Cecily).1,7,2,3,4,5 John Gyse, Esq. died on 20 December 1556 at Brockworth, Gloucestershire, England; Buried at Elmore, Gloucestershire.1,2,4

  • Ancestral roots of certain American colonists who came to America before ... By Frederick Lewis Weis, Walter Lee Sheppard, David Faris
  • http://books.google.com/books?id=XLqEWwa7fT8C&pg=PA166&lpg=PA166&dq...
  • Pg. 166
  • 34. ALICE WYSHAM, d. 1487; m. John Guise (or Gyse), Esq., of Apsley Guise and Holt, sheriff of Gloucestershire 1454, 1470-1471. (VCH Worc. III 298, 404; VCH Warwick VI 47; Burke's Peerage (1938), pp. 1174-1175).
  • 35. JOHN GYSE (or GUISE), KNT., of Apsley Guise, co. Beckford, and Elmore, co. Gloucester, d. 30 Sep. 1501, Inq.p.m. 17 Hen. VII no. 18., Papal disp. for m. 15 May 17 Apr. (o.s.) 1484 to Anne Berkeley of Stoke Gifford, his wife who survived him. By her, father of No. 36. A monumental brass, dated 1501, for Sir John Guise is preserved in the parish church of Apsley Guise, co. Bedford. (VCH Worc. III 404; Burke's Peerage (1938) 1174-1175; Trans. Bristol and Gloucs.Arch.Soc. III 57-58; Mill Stephenson, A List of Monumental Brasses in the British Isles (1926), p. 1).
  • 36. JOHN GYSE, ESQ., of Elmore, co. Gloucester, b. ca. 1485 (ae. 16+ at father's death), d. at Brockworth, co. Gloucester, 20 Dec. 1556, bur. Elmore, Inq.p.m. 3 and 4 Philip and Mary pt. 2, no. 73; m. ca. 1510 TACY (TASY, THOMASINE) DE GREY (207-39), bur. Elmore 15 Nov. 1558, dau. "Lord Grey de Wilton". Dec. 13, 31 Hen. VIII (1539) John Gyse and Tasy, and their son Anselme and his wife Alice (prob. just m.) exchanged manor and lordships of "Asple Gyse, co. Beds., and Wyggyngton, co. Oxon" with the King for manor and lordship of Brockworth, etc. Deed recites that John Gyse had indentured 24 Feb. 10 Hen. VIII (1518-9) convenanting to convey to his young son Anselme on m. to Alice, dau. James Clifford of Frampton-upon-Severne, estates in Wyggyngton, and in further agreements same date both parents undertook to share equally the costs of "school learning, meat, drink, apparel" of Anselme until aged 17, and if Alice die, Anselme to have another Clifford dau. within 10 years of his age. Anselme d.s.p. 9 May 1563 (Inq.p.m. 5 Eliz No. 22) next heir his brother William aged 49+. (Bristol and Gloucs., cit. 59-61).
  • 37. WILLIAM GYSE, 2nd son but event. h., b. ca. 1514, d. 7 Sep 1574 (Inq.p.m. 17 Eliz. No. 50), bur. Elmore 9 Sep. 1574, will dated 10 Mar. 1568-9, Gloucs.; m. Mary, dau John Rotsy of Colmore, King's Norton, co. Worcester, by Margaret, dau.
  • Pg. 167
  • John Walsh of Sheldesley Walsh, co. Worcester, bur. 24 Nov. 1558 at Elmore. (Cit. 61-2, 70). ______________________________
